At the time of this writing the resolution for generative fill is 1k. That 1024×1024 pixels.There are several reasons for this, mainly the massive computing power required and this is currently in beta.

It’s not a new problem, but now the floodgates are open. Instead of cold brew coffee, we can select the glass on the left and enter ‘Pint of beer’ as the prompt. Notice that not only is the glass slightly out of focus to match the depth of field of what it replaced, it also includes a hint of a reflection of the raspberry tart in front of it and the coffee to the side. But when you just want to extend the edge of your image, leave the prompt box empty so Photoshop knows to fill the area with content that matches the original photo. A prompt box appears where you can enter text to describe what you want to fill the selected area with. Make sure your selection outline overlaps a bit of the image as well so the AI-generated content can blend seamlessly with the original detail. In the Properties panel, you can view the variations and click on the thumbnail previews to see the results on your image. This allows you to explore numerous creative possibilities and easily revert back to the original image without affecting it.
